#994462 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#994462 is composed of 60% red, 26.7%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 35.9%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 338.8 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 43.3%. #994462 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88c4 with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#994462 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#994462 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#994462 has RGB values of R:153, G:68,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.36,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10044514.

Shades and Tints of #994462

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#994462

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77666c is the less saturated color, while #dd004e is the most saturated one.
